Rob Gray — Fun fact: The Cyclones haven’t lost a Big 12 game at Jack Trice Stadium in the past 1,064 days. Oklahoma State is the last league foe to win in Ames, recording a 34-27 triumph on Oct. 26, 2019. The Cyclones have won a program-record 11 straight conference home games since that setback. But history doesn’t factor into Saturday’s matchup, of course. The team that plays cleaner football usually wins in fairly even matchups like this one. I expect the defending Big 12 champion Bears to edge the Cyclones in that area — and barely end a remarkable streak in the final seconds. Baylor 21, Iowa State 20

How to watch Iowa State football vs. Baylor
Kickoff time: 11 a.m. (CT)
TV: ESPN2
Live stream: ESPN.com
TV announcers: Tiffany Greene (play-by-play), Rocky Boiman (color), Dawn Davenport (sideline)
Radio: Cyclone Radio Network, including 1600 AM, 102.3 FM (Cedar Rapids) and 106.3 FM (Iowa City)
Listen online: The Varsity Network
